Noha khawani is one of the most revered forms of religious recitations in the Muslim world, especially amongst the Shia community. In the past, many gifted noha khawans have been celebrated internationally for their highly expressive voices, poignant poetry, and their success in evoking and engaging their listeners with the message of Karbala. With social media, YouTube and digital streams, today's noha reciters have become world famous.

Nohas are heard by millions of people from Pakistan and India to the Middle East, Europe and North America in the month of Muharram and even all year round. There are some reciters whose artistic styles, compositions and decades of efforts in the preservation of this spiritual tradition have made them household names.

In this article, we will delve into some of the most popular and impactful world-class noha khawans of today.

Increasing Popularity of Noha Khawani

Noha recitation has undergone many changes in the last few decades. The earliest generations mostly hear the nohas in the context of religious meetings or majalis. In the present day, reciters can communicate with the audience on other continents using digital platforms.

With the advent of modern production techniques, good recordings and multilingual recitations Noha Khawans have managed to reach younger listeners and still maintain the essence of the tradition. Community conversations frequently include the ways in which modern reciters have increased the world visibility of noha khawani through video making and touring internationally.

Nadeem Sarwar

When it comes to the most popular noha khawans in the world, Nadeem Sarwar's name is frequently mentioned.

Nadeem Sarwar, popularly called "Safeer e Aza", has been reciting nohas for over four decades and is one of the most famous reciters of nohas in the world. He has performed hundreds of nohas in various languages such as Urdu, Arabic, English, Punjabi, Sindhi and Persian. He has made international tours developed a contemporary production style, and introduced Noha Khawani to newer generations around the world.

Hassan Sadiq

Hassan Sadiq has been one of the most respected names in the field of nōhā khawānī for decades.

He is famous for his distinctive "Dohra" style and is still inspiring young reciters with his ability to recite thousands of nohas. His traditional style is very attractive to those who enjoy listening to noha in its traditional style and at the same time is reaching a younger crowd via digital platforms.

Farhan Ali Waris

Farhan Ali Waris is another globally popular noha khawan with a devoted fan base in Pakistan India the Middle East Europe and North America.

He started performing professionally in the 1990s releasing many popular albums through Audio Noha Recording and still being a wellknown entertainer during the Muharram season. His dynamic recitation style and powerful stage presence have contributed significantly to his popularity.

The Role of Social Media in the Rise of Noha Khawans

Social media and digital streaming platforms have played a significant role in the success of many noha khawans, contributing to their global recognition.

Nohas had been played mostly in the past during religious services, for majalis and processions. Platforms like YouTube, Facebook, Instagram and TikTok provide reciters today with the means to upload their work to audiences around the world in real time. Here are the key advantages:

Global Reach

In Pakistan, a noha is recorded and within a few minutes can be heard by listeners in Canada, Australia, the United Kingdom and the Middle East.

Greater Accessibility

Nohas are accessible to people all year round, not just during Muharram.

Connect with Younger Audiences

A series of short clips, reels and digital content assist younger generations in discovering and enjoying noha khawani.

Improved Production Quality

The quality of audio and video productions has been improved greatly with the use of modern recording technology. There are many professional Noha Recording Studios in Pakistan and all over the world.

Due to these developments, noha khawani is no longer a regional tradition, but rather a global phenomenon.
